Assenhütte
Assenhütte is a restaurant in Schenna, South Tyrol, Trentino-Alto Adige. Assenhütte is situated nearby to the grassland Videgger Assen, as well as near Pfarregge.- Opening hours: May—October Tuesday—Sunday 9:30 AM—5:00 PM
- Type: Restaurant
